E-COMMERCE MCQs

This comprehensive collection of E-Commerce MCQs is specifically crafted to enhance understanding of the fundamental concepts and practices that drive online commerce. Covering key topics such as e-commerce models, digital payment systems, online marketing strategies, supply chain management, and website optimization, these questions aim to reinforce both theoretical knowledge and practical application. Ideal for students studying business, marketing, or information technology, as well as professionals preparing for certification exams or seeking to deepen their expertise in the e-commerce landscape, this set focuses on the essential elements that contribute to successful online business operations.

1. What does eCommerce stand for?

A) Electronic Commerce
B) Enhanced Commerce
C) Electronic Communication
D) External Commerce

View Answer
A

 

2. Which of the following is NOT a type of eCommerce?

A) B2B
B) B2C
C) C2C
D) P2P

View Answer
D

 

3. What is the main purpose of an eCommerce website?

A) To provide entertainment
B) To sell products or services online
C) To share social media content
D) To display ads

View Answer
B

 

4. Which payment method is commonly used in eCommerce transactions?

A) Cash on delivery
B) Credit/debit cards
C) Digital wallets
D) All of the above

View Answer
D

 

5. What does B2C stand for?

A) Business to Customer
B) Business to Client
C) Buyer to Consumer
D) Business to Company

View Answer
A

 

6. Which platform is commonly used for eCommerce websites?

A) WordPress
B) Magento
C) Shopify
D) All of the above

View Answer
D

 

7. What does SEO stand for in the context of eCommerce?

A) Sales Enhancement Optimization
B) Search Engine Optimization
C) Social Engagement Online
D) Strategic E-commerce Operations

View Answer
B

 

8. Which of the following is a benefit of eCommerce?

A) 24/7 Availability
B) Lower operational costs
C) Global reach
D) All of the above

View Answer
D

 

9. What is the purpose of a shopping cart in eCommerce?

A) To display ads
B) To allow users to select and purchase items
C) To collect user data
D) To showcase promotions

View Answer
B

 

10. Which of the following is a common feature of eCommerce websites?

A) User accounts
B) Product reviews
C) Secure payment options
D) All of the above

View Answer
D

 

11. What does C2C stand for?

A) Customer to Customer
B) Client to Client
C) Company to Customer
D) Consumer to Consumer

View Answer
A

 

12. Which of the following is an example of an online marketplace?

A) Amazon
B) eBay
C) Etsy
D) All of the above

View Answer
D

 

13. What is the primary function of a payment gateway in eCommerce?

A) To process transactions securely
B) To design websites
C) To host eCommerce platforms
D) To manage inventory

View Answer
A

 

14. What does dropshipping refer to in eCommerce?

A) Shipping products directly to consumers
B) Selling products without holding inventory
C) Creating drop-down menus on websites
D) Offering discounted shipping rates

View Answer
B

 

15. What is a common method for eCommerce businesses to reach customers?

A) Social media marketing
B) Email marketing
C) Search engine advertising
D) All of the above

View Answer
D

 

16. Which term describes the practice of optimizing online stores for search engines?

A) SEO
B) SEM
C) SMM
D) PPC

View Answer
A

 

17. What is an affiliate program in eCommerce?

A) A loyalty program for customers
B) A partnership to promote products for a commission
C) A service to design websites
D) A method to collect customer feedback

View Answer
B

 

18. Which of the following is NOT a digital marketing strategy?

A) Content marketing
B) Traditional advertising
C) Social media marketing
D) Email marketing

View Answer
B

 

19. What does PPC stand for in online advertising?

A) Pay Per Click
B) Pay Per Conversion
C) Pay Per Customer
D) Pay Per Call

View Answer
A

 

20. What is a common metric to measure eCommerce performance?

A) Page views
B) Conversion rate
C) Bounce rate
D) All of the above

View Answer
D

 

21. Which of the following is a common type of eCommerce fraud?

A) Identity theft
B) Phishing
C) Credit card fraud
D) All of the above

View Answer
D

 

22. What is the purpose of a customer review section on an eCommerce site?

A) To promote competitors
B) To gather customer feedback and build trust
C) To display product images
D) To increase page load time

View Answer
B

 

23. What is a loyalty program in eCommerce?

A) A strategy to attract new customers
B) A way to reward repeat customers
C) A method to reduce shipping costs
D) A way to enhance website security

View Answer
B

 

24. Which eCommerce model involves selling directly to consumers without intermediaries?

A) B2B
B) C2C
C) B2C
D) C2B

View Answer
C

 

25. What is the function of an SSL certificate in eCommerce?

A) To increase website speed
B) To secure data transmission
C) To improve search engine ranking
D) To analyze user behavior

View Answer
B

 

26. What does the term “conversion rate” refer to?

A) The percentage of visitors who make a purchase
B) The number of products sold
C) The amount of revenue generated
D) The number of website visitors

View Answer
A

 

27. Which of the following platforms is known for selling handmade items?

A) Amazon
B) Etsy
C) eBay
D) Alibaba

View Answer
B

 

28. What is a common reason for cart abandonment in eCommerce?

A) High shipping costs
B) Complicated checkout process
C) Lack of payment options
D) All of the above

View Answer
D

 

29. Which of the following payment methods is considered a digital wallet?

A) PayPal
B) Credit card
C) Cash
D) Check

View Answer
A

 

30. What is the main purpose of retargeting ads in eCommerce?

A) To attract new customers
B) To remind previous visitors of products they viewed
C) To increase social media followers
D) To reduce marketing costs

View Answer
B

 

31. What does the term “customer lifetime value” (CLV) represent?

A) The average amount spent by a customer over time
B) The total number of customers
C) The amount of time a customer spends on a website
D) The cost of acquiring a customer

View Answer
A

 

32. Which of the following is a feature of responsive web design?

A) Fixed layout
B) Adapts to different screen sizes
C) Uses Flash animations
D) Requires a separate mobile site

View Answer
B

 

33. What does “A/B testing” involve in eCommerce?

A) Testing two different website designs to see which performs better
B) Testing two payment methods
C) Testing customer service responses
D) Testing inventory management systems

View Answer
A

 

34. What is a common way to improve eCommerce site speed?

A) Reducing image sizes
B) Increasing product descriptions
C) Using more advertisements
D) Adding more plugins

View Answer
A

 

35. Which of the following is an example of an omnichannel strategy?

A) Selling only through a physical store
B) Integrating online and offline sales channels
C) Focusing solely on social media marketing
D) Using only email for customer communication

View Answer
B

 

36. What does the term “shipping policy” refer to in eCommerce?

A) Guidelines for product returns
B) Rules regarding delivery times and costs
C) Procedures for processing payments
D) Marketing strategies

View Answer
B

 

37. What is the main advantage of using customer segmentation in eCommerce?

A) To treat all customers the same
B) To tailor marketing strategies for different customer groups
C) To increase product prices
D) To reduce inventory

View Answer
B

 

38. What is the purpose of a product recommendation engine?

A) To suggest products based on user behavior
B) To generate sales reports
C) To manage inventory
D) To design the website

View Answer
A

 

39. What is the key focus of inbound marketing in eCommerce?

A) Interrupting potential customers
B) Attracting customers through valuable content
C) Using aggressive sales tactics
D) Focusing solely on email campaigns

View Answer
B

 

40. Which of the following is a common form of online advertising?

A) Display ads
B) Sponsored content
C) Social media ads
D) All of the above

View Answer
D

 

41. What is the term for the practice of personalizing the shopping experience for customers?

A) Segmentation
B) Customization
C) Targeting
D) Optimization

View Answer
B

 

42. What does “customer acquisition cost” (CAC) measure?

A) The total revenue from a customer
B) The cost of obtaining a new customer
C) The cost of shipping products
D) The average spending of a customer

View Answer
B

 

43. Which eCommerce model allows consumers to sell goods directly to other consumers?

A) B2C
B) C2C
C) B2B
D) C2B

View Answer
B

 

44. What is the significance of product images on an eCommerce site?

A) They take up space on the page
B) They can influence purchase decisions
C) They are only for decoration
D) They are not necessary

View Answer
B

 

45. What is an example of a business-to-business (B2B) eCommerce site?

A) Amazon
B) Alibaba
C) eBay
D) Etsy

View Answer
B

 

46. What does “user experience” (UX) refer to in eCommerce?

A) The ease of navigating a website
B) The design of a website
C) The loading speed of a website
D) All of the above

View Answer
D

 

47. Which of the following can help reduce shopping cart abandonment?

A) Offering free shipping
B) Simplifying the checkout process
C) Providing multiple payment options
D) All of the above

View Answer
D

 

48. What does “local SEO” focus on in eCommerce?

A) Attracting global customers
B) Optimizing a website for local search results
C) Selling products internationally
D) None of the above

View Answer
B

 

49. What is the purpose of a privacy policy on an eCommerce website?

A) To describe shipping methods
B) To inform users about data collection and usage
C) To outline return policies
D) To detail payment options

View Answer
B

 

50. What does “conversion funnel” refer to in eCommerce?

A) A method of filtering products
B) The steps a customer takes from awareness to purchase
C) A process for managing inventory
D) A way to analyze website traffic

View Answer
B

 

51. Which of the following is a common form of social proof in eCommerce?

A) Customer reviews
B) Product images
C) Shipping information
D) Return policies

View Answer
A

 

52. What is a common reason for consumers to prefer online shopping?

A) Convenience
B) Higher prices
C) Limited selection
D) Longer wait times

View Answer
A

 

53. What is an eCommerce marketplace?

A) A website where multiple sellers can offer their products
B) A physical store
C) A type of advertisement
D) A customer service platform

View Answer
A

 

54. Which of the following describes “big data” in eCommerce?

A) Small amounts of customer information
B) Large volumes of structured and unstructured data
C) Data that is difficult to analyze
D) Data that is only relevant to a specific product

View Answer
B

 

55. What is “omni-channel retailing”?

A) Selling through multiple online platforms only
B) Integrating various sales channels for a seamless customer experience
C) Focusing only on physical stores
D) None of the above

View Answer
B

 

56. What is a subscription model in eCommerce?

A) A one-time purchase model
B) A model where customers pay regularly for access to products or services
C) A model where customers only pay for shipping
D) A model for retail only

View Answer
B

 

57. What is a common benefit of using chatbots in eCommerce?

A) They reduce human interaction
B) They can provide 24/7 customer service
C) They are only for sales purposes
D) They do not collect user data

View Answer
B

 

58. What is a key challenge for eCommerce businesses regarding customer data?

A) Collecting too much data
B) Data security and privacy concerns
C) Data analysis
D) All of the above

View Answer
B

 

59. What is a “flash sale” in eCommerce?

A) A sale that lasts for a short time with significant discounts
B) A sale that occurs every month
C) A sale that features new products only
D) A sale for loyal customers only

View Answer
A

 

60. Which of the following is an effective way to enhance customer retention?

A) Frequent discounts
B) Excellent customer service
C) Ignoring customer feedback
D) Complicated return policies

View Answer
B

 

61. What does “inventory management” involve in eCommerce?

A) Managing customer data
B) Tracking stock levels and orders
C) Designing product pages
D) Running marketing campaigns

View Answer
B

 

62. What is the purpose of an “abandoned cart email”?

A) To promote unrelated products
B) To remind customers of items left in their cart
C) To encourage users to visit social media
D) To notify users of policy changes

View Answer
B

 

63. What is “market segmentation” in eCommerce?

A) Dividing a market into distinct groups of buyers
B) Selling products to international markets
C) Analyzing competitor websites
D) Merging businesses

View Answer
A

 

64. What is the role of a “call to action” (CTA) in eCommerce?

A) To increase website traffic
B) To encourage users to take a specific action
C) To analyze customer behavior
D) To display product features

View Answer
B

 

65. Which of the following best describes “lead generation”?

A) Attracting potential customers to a business
B) Selling products directly
C) Managing inventory
D) Shipping products

View Answer
A

 

66. What is a “landing page” in the context of eCommerce?

A) The homepage of a website
B) A page designed for a specific marketing campaign
C) A page that contains product details only
D) A page that is no longer in use

View Answer
B

 

67. Which of the following can enhance the customer experience in eCommerce?

A) Personalized recommendations
B) Complex navigation
C) Lack of product information
D) Long loading times

View Answer
A

 

68. What does “first-party data” refer to in eCommerce?

A) Data collected from third-party sources
B) Data collected directly from customers
C) Data shared by competitors
D) None of the above

View Answer
B

 

69. What is the significance of “customer feedback” in eCommerce?

A) It is irrelevant to business growth
B) It helps improve products and services
C) It complicates the decision-making process
D) It is only useful for marketing purposes

View Answer
B

 

70. Which eCommerce term refers to the practice of selling products through a subscription model?

A) Pay-per-click
B) Subscription commerce
C) Social commerce
D) B2C

View Answer
B

 

71. What is “return on investment” (ROI) in eCommerce?

A) The total revenue from sales
B) The percentage of profit made on an investment
C) The cost of marketing campaigns
D) The number of new customers acquired

View Answer
B

 

72. Which of the following is a common challenge faced by eCommerce businesses?

A) Managing online reviews
B) Attracting website visitors
C) Handling logistics and shipping
D) All of the above

View Answer
D

 

73. What is the purpose of a “customer journey map” in eCommerce?

A) To outline the steps a customer takes when interacting with a brand
B) To manage inventory levels
C) To track shipping information
D) To analyze competitor pricing

View Answer
A

 

74. What does “email marketing” aim to achieve in eCommerce?

A) To increase website traffic
B) To communicate directly with customers and drive sales
C) To promote social media accounts
D) To collect customer data

View Answer
B

 

75. What is the significance of “website analytics” in eCommerce?

A) To monitor website speed
B) To analyze user behavior and improve marketing strategies
C) To design product pages
D) To create advertisements

View Answer
B

 

76. What does “mobile optimization” involve in eCommerce?

A) Making websites accessible on mobile devices
B) Creating separate mobile websites
C) Reducing the number of mobile users
D) None of the above

View Answer
A

 

77. What does the term “customer support” refer to in eCommerce?

A) Assistance provided to customers before and after a purchase
B) Marketing strategies
C) Website design
D) Product management

View Answer
A

 

78. Which of the following describes “influencer marketing”?

A) Using celebrities to promote products
B) Partnering with individuals who have a large following to promote products
C) Only using email campaigns
D) Focusing solely on paid advertisements

View Answer
B

 

79. What is the function of an “order management system” (OMS) in eCommerce?

A) To manage customer accounts
B) To track inventory levels
C) To handle order processing and fulfillment
D) To create marketing campaigns

View Answer
C

 

80. Which of the following is a common characteristic of a successful eCommerce website?

A) Poor navigation
B) Mobile responsiveness
C) Lack of product descriptions
D) Slow loading times

View Answer
B

 

81. What is the main advantage of using live chat support on an eCommerce site?

A) It increases website traffic
B) It allows for real-time customer assistance
C) It reduces website speed
D) It requires extensive training

View Answer
B

 

82. What is the role of “content marketing” in eCommerce?

A) To sell products directly
B) To create valuable content to attract and engage customers
C) To reduce website traffic
D) To manage customer accounts

View Answer
B

 

83. What does “affiliate marketing” involve in eCommerce?

A) A partnership with other businesses to share resources
B) A commission-based system to promote products
C) Selling products at a discount
D) Offering free products to customers

View Answer
B

 

84. What is a “flash sale” in eCommerce?

A) A sale that lasts for a limited time
B) A permanent discount
C) A sale that is only online
D) A sale for only loyal customers

View Answer
A

 

85. What is a “pop-up shop”?

A) A physical store that appears for a short time
B) An online store
C) A social media campaign
D) A type of marketing strategy

View Answer
A

 

86. What does “eCommerce SEO” involve?

A) Optimizing an eCommerce website for search engines
B) Creating advertisements for eCommerce sites
C) Designing product pages
D) Managing customer data

View Answer
A

 

87. What is a “supply chain” in eCommerce?

A) A network between a company and its suppliers to produce and distribute products
B) A method of customer service
C) A marketing strategy
D) A product return process

View Answer
A

 

88. What is “content curation” in eCommerce?

A) Creating original content only
B) Selecting and sharing relevant content to engage customers
C) Ignoring customer feedback
D) None of the above

View Answer
B

 

89. What is the function of “order fulfillment” in eCommerce?

A) Processing payments only
B) Preparing and shipping products to customers
C) Managing customer accounts
D) Creating advertisements

View Answer
B

 

90. Which of the following is a common factor in the success of an eCommerce business?

A) User-friendly website design
B) Complex navigation
C) Limited payment options
D) High shipping costs

View Answer
A

 

91. What does “lead nurturing” involve in eCommerce?

A) Ignoring potential customers
B) Building relationships with leads through targeted communication
C) Reducing marketing efforts
D) None of the above

View Answer
B

 

92. What is “search engine marketing” (SEM)?

A) Optimizing website content only
B) Promoting websites through paid advertising on search engines
C) Creating social media campaigns
D) Ignoring online advertising

View Answer
B

 

93. What is the significance of “customer personas” in eCommerce?

A) They help in understanding target customers and tailoring marketing strategies
B) They complicate the marketing process
C) They are irrelevant for eCommerce
D) None of the above

View Answer
A

 

94. What is the main purpose of a “satisfaction survey” in eCommerce?

A) To increase sales
B) To gather feedback on customer experiences
C) To reduce website traffic
D) To manage inventory

View Answer
B

 

95. What is a “buyer’s journey” in eCommerce?

A) The process a customer goes through when making a purchase decision
B) The steps involved in shipping a product
C) The way a business manages customer data
D) None of the above

View Answer
A

 

96. What does “brand loyalty” refer to in eCommerce?

A) Customers consistently choosing a particular brand over others
B) The number of new customers acquired
C) The total revenue generated
D) None of the above

View Answer
A

 

97. What is a “competitive analysis” in eCommerce?

A) Analyzing a company’s internal processes
B) Evaluating competitors’ strengths and weaknesses
C) A method of managing customer feedback
D) None of the above

View Answer
B

 

98. What is “social commerce”?

A) Selling products on social media platforms
B) Only focusing on online marketplaces
C) Using email marketing exclusively
D) None of the above

View Answer
A

 

99. What does “retargeting” mean in eCommerce?

A) Attracting new customers
B) Advertising to users who have previously visited a website
C) Selling products at a discount
D) None of the above

View Answer
B

 

100. What is a “call-to-action” (CTA)?

A) A method of collecting data
B) A prompt for the user to take a specific action
C) An advertisement
D) A type of product

View Answer
B
